Types of Mini Portable Ultrasound Machines

Handheld Ultrasound Machines

Handheld ultrasound devices are designed for maximum portability and ease of use. They typically connect to smartphones or tablets, enabling healthcare professionals to conduct ultrasounds on-the-go. These devices are ideal for emergency situations or in-field diagnostics, making them invaluable in various healthcare settings.

Compact Ultrasound Machines

Compact ultrasound machines strike a balance between portability and functionality. These devices are lightweight yet equipped with advanced imaging capabilities. They are commonly used in hospitals for bedside imaging and in rural clinics where access to larger machines may be limited.

Wireless Ultrasound Machines

Wireless ultrasound machines offer unparalleled convenience, eliminating the need for cables and allowing for greater mobility. These devices are often used in sports medicine and home healthcare, where quick assessments are crucial. Their user-friendly interfaces make them accessible to a wide range of users.

Full-Feature Portable Ultrasound Machines

These machines combine the portability of smaller devices with the advanced features typically found in larger ultrasound systems. They are designed for healthcare professionals who require high-quality imaging across multiple applications. Their larger screens and enhanced capabilities make them suitable for various clinical environments.

Applications of Mini Portable Ultrasound Machines

Emergency Services

In emergency medical situations, time is of the essence. Mini portable ultrasound machines enable quick and accurate assessments, allowing for rapid decision-making. Devices like the Mindray TE X Ultrasound System are designed to meet the demands of fast-paced environments.

Rural Healthcare

Access to healthcare in rural areas can be limited. Mini portable ultrasound machines provide essential imaging capabilities, improving patient outcomes by facilitating quicker diagnoses. The compact nature of these devices makes them ideal for use in clinics and home healthcare settings.

Sports Medicine

Athletic trainers and sports physicians often utilize portable ultrasound machines to evaluate injuries on the spot. These devices allow for immediate assessment, guiding treatment decisions and rehabilitation plans. DR.SONO’s offerings are particularly popular in this niche.

Obstetrics

In obstetric care, portable ultrasound machines are invaluable for monitoring fetal development. The Philips Lumify, for example, includes tools for assessing early-stage fetal growth, making it a crucial device for practitioners in this field.

FAQ

What is a mini portable ultrasound machine?
A mini portable ultrasound machine is a compact imaging device that allows healthcare professionals to perform ultrasounds in various settings. They are lightweight, easy to transport, and often equipped with advanced imaging technology.

How does a handheld ultrasound work?
Handheld ultrasounds work by emitting sound waves that bounce off tissues and organs, creating images based on the echoes received. These devices often connect to smartphones or tablets for display and analysis.

What are the advantages of using portable ultrasound machines?
Portable ultrasound machines provide convenience, quick diagnostics, and accessibility. They are especially useful in emergency situations and rural healthcare settings where traditional machines may not be available.

Can I use a portable ultrasound machine for obstetrics?
Yes, many portable ultrasound machines, such as the Philips Lumify, are designed for obstetric applications, allowing for monitoring of fetal growth and health.

What is the typical battery life of a portable ultrasound machine?
Battery life varies by model, ranging from 2 to 10 hours, depending on the device’s features and usage. It’s essential to check specifications for each model.

Are portable ultrasound machines accurate?
Yes, portable ultrasound machines can provide accurate imaging comparable to traditional systems. Advances in technology have significantly enhanced their image quality and diagnostic capabilities.

How much do mini portable ultrasound machines cost?
Prices for mini portable ultrasound machines vary widely based on features and brand, typically ranging from $1,000 to $12,000.

What types of healthcare settings benefit from portable ultrasound machines?
Portable ultrasound machines are beneficial in emergency rooms, rural clinics, sports medicine facilities, and home healthcare settings, providing quick and efficient imaging solutions.

Do portable ultrasound machines require special training to use?
While basic operation can be learned quickly, healthcare professionals should have formal training in ultrasound techniques to ensure accurate diagnostics and patient safety.

Can portable ultrasound machines connect to other devices?
Yes, many portable ultrasound machines offer connectivity options such as Bluetooth and Wi-Fi to connect with smartphones, tablets, and other devices for enhanced functionality and data sharing.
